Hi, I’m Lauren
BACP-registered counsellor and clinical supervisor with over 10 years' experience supporting children and young people.
I work with children and young people in schools, community settings and online, supporting them through a wide range of challenges including anxiety, low mood, bereavement, self-esteem difficulties, family conflict and life transitions.
Drawing on person-centred counselling, attachment theory, play therapy and solution-focused approaches, I create a safe space where young people can explore their feelings in ways that feel natural and accessible to them.

My Counselling Approach
A safe space for children and young people
Not every child or young person finds it easy to explain how they feel.
That's why sessions can include creative and play-based methods, helping young people express themselves without pressure and explore emotions in ways that feel comfortable for them.
I work in a non-directive, confidential and relational way, building a safe therapeutic relationship where young people can develop self-understanding, confidence and emotional resilience at their own pace.

My Counselling Services

Counselling for children and young people
In-person counselling sessions are available at Bingley Counselling Centre for children and young people of all ages.
Sessions offer a calm, supportive and confidential space to explore emotions safely. For younger children, therapy may include creative and play-based approaches to help them communicate and process feelings in ways that feel accessible.
£60 per session
Sessions last 50 minutes
Face-to-face in Bingley

Online counselling for young people
Online counselling is available via Zoom for young people aged 11+.
This can be a flexible option for young people who feel more comfortable accessing support from home, while still receiving warm, professional therapeutic support.
£50 per session
Sessions last 50 minutes
Online via Zoom
